How This Is Calculated
Minnesota uses a progressive income tax system. Each bracket's rate applies only to income within that range.
| Rate | Income Range (Single) |
|---|---|
| 5.35% | $0 – $31,690 |
| 6.80% | $31,690 – $104,090 |
| 7.85% | $104,090 – $183,340 |
| 9.85% | $183,340 – No limit |

- What is the Minnesota income tax rate for 2025?
- Minnesota uses a progressive income tax system with rates ranging from 5.35% to 9.85%. Top rate of 9.85% — one of the highest in the nation. Brackets are indexed for inflation annually.
